A note of today's visitors:

Herky 638 - USAFE C-130J - 06-8610 - in/out
Madfox 50 - USN P-8A - 168437/LA - returned from a sortie.
Python 1 - Hawk T2 - ZK029/T - flew local, still present when I left
Python 2 - Hawk T2 - ZK010/A - flew a local, still present when I left
Victor Yankee Tango 67 - Hawk T2 - ZK023/N - flew a local, still present when I left
Victor Yankee Tango 62 - Hawk T2 - ZK012/C - flew a local, still present when I left
Lima Oscar Papa 43 - Tucano T1 - ZF407 - still present when I left
Lima Oscar Papa 45 - Tucano T1 - ZF142 - still present when I left

Non Flyers:
USN P-8A - 168438/LA
RCAF Cp-140 - 140115

Kris the Typhoons will use the active runway which is 23/05. Runway 23 landing from north coming in over the beach.With 05 sometimes in use landing from the south and on departure head north over the airfield and golf course.
QRA "live" use shorter 10/28 runway and normally take off to the east before going on track.
